The core principle is remarkably simple to understand, yet surprisingly complex to master. Players place a bet, and a multiplier begins to increase. The longer the game continues, the higher the multiplier climbs, exponentially increasing the potential payout. However, at any random moment, the game ‘crashes,’ and any bets not cashed out before the crash point are lost. This dynamic creates a uniquely stressful and exhilarating loop, demanding quick thinking and a solid understanding of probabilities, coupled with a considerable amount of self-control. Understanding the Mechanics and Volatility

At its heart, the appeal of this type of game lies in its straightforward mechanics. A player initiates a round by placing a bet. The game then displays a steadily increasing multiplier, visually representing the potential return on investment. The inherent uncertainty of when the game will crash is what drives the excitement and dictates the strategic choices players must make. The randomness is often powered by a provably fair system, using cryptographic algorithms to ensure transparency and prevent manipulation. This aspect is crucial in building trust with players. Understanding the underlying probabilities, even at a basic level, can significantly improve a player's chances of success. While the crash point is genuinely random, grasping the concept of average crash multipliers and the potential for streaks can inform betting strategies.

The Psychology of the Crash

Beyond the mathematical elements, a significant component of success in this game rests on psychological fortitude. The temptation to wait for a higher multiplier is powerful, fueled by the desire for larger profits. However, this greed can easily lead to losing everything. Disciplined players often employ strategies such as setting pre-defined ‘cash out’ points, regardless of the current multiplier, or utilizing automated cash-out features. Recognizing one's own risk tolerance and avoiding emotional decision-making are paramount. The human brain is prone to several biases – loss aversion (feeling the pain of a loss more strongly than the pleasure of an equivalent gain) and the gambler’s fallacy (believing that past events influence future independent events) – all of which can cloud judgement during gameplay.

Developing Effective Betting Strategies

There are numerous betting strategies players employ,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Some prefer a conservative approach, consistently cashing out at lower multipliers (e.g., 1.2x – 1.5x) to secure small but frequent profits. This method prioritizes minimizing risk over maximizing potential gains. Others opt for a more aggressive strategy, aiming for higher multipliers (e.g., 2.0x+) but accepting a higher probability of losing their stake. This approach requires significant discipline and a larger bankroll to withstand potential losses. A common tactic is 'martingale,' where a player doubles their bet after each loss, hoping to recover previous losses with a single win. However, this strategy can quickly deplete one's bankroll and is not recommended for inexperienced players.

Bankroll Management: A Foundation for Success

Regardless of the chosen strategy, robust bankroll management is absolutely essential. A ‘unit’ is a standard bet size, typically representing 1-5% of the total bankroll. Players should predetermine the maximum number of consecutive losses they are willing to tolerate before ceasing play or adjusting their strategy. Diversifying bets – placing multiple smaller bets simultaneously with different cash-out points – can help mitigate risk. Treating the game as a form of entertainment, rather than a guaranteed source of income, is crucial for maintaining a healthy perspective. Chasing losses is a common pitfall, and a pre-defined stop-loss limit is a powerful tool to prevent impulsive decisions.

Utilizing Auto Cash-Out Features

Many platforms now offer auto cash-out features, which allow players to pre-set a desired multiplier at which their bet will automatically be cashed out. This removes the pressure of manually reacting to the rising multiplier and can prevent impulsive decisions driven by greed or fear. Auto cash-out is particularly useful for executing consistent strategies, such as regularly cashing out at 1.5x or 2.0x. It also allows players to manage multiple simultaneous bets more efficiently. However, it’s important to note that auto cash-out doesn't eliminate risk entirely. The game can still crash before the set multiplier is reached. Furthermore, relying solely on auto cash-out may discourage players from developing their own timing and judgment skills.
